Once the doctor breaks the news about kidney disease, the patient goes through shock, denial, emotional distress, anger, depression and many other emotions before accepting and seeking help. Specific anxieties that renal patients may have include: Worries about how the illness will affect your relationships, Your ability to work, Your finances, Your quality of life, You may also be anxious about understanding your condition or managing your treatment.

Many patients find that they can regain a sense of control by learning as much as they can about kidney failure and treatment. Becoming an expert enables them to participate more actively in making decisions.

Diabetes is also known as sugar. It is a disease where the body has problem with a hormone called insulin. Insulin helps your body use the sugar you eat for energy. When your body doesn’t use insulin the way it should, too much sugar starts to accumulate in your body and starts to cause some damage. Blood sugar should be kept as close to normal as possible. This will help slow down kidney damage and help prevent other problems such as heart disease, stroke, amputation and blindness.

High blood pressure is also called hypertension. Only diabetes causes more kidney failure than high blood pressure. Blood pressure is the force of the blood against the arteries as it flows through the body. Your blood pressure changes during the day. Exercise, stress and other factors can change your blood pressure. A less than 120/80 is considered as a normal blood pressure.

All human beings find change stressful – even the change that we are looking forward to. Renal failure patient will have to deal with more change than most people do. Not just the initial change of lifestyle after diagnosis, but ongoing changes like diet, medication and other challenges. All these changes mean you have to learn more and make decisions. You also have to adjust to doing less than you would like to and asking for help. This could be extremely stressful.
